Title: To authorize the Director of Public Utilities to enter into a construction contract with Evans Landscaping, Inc., in the amount of $6,916,818.38 for the 5th Ave Dam Removal and Lower Olentangy River Ecosystem Restoration Project; to enter into a sub-agreement contract with The Ohio State University to accept and expend $2,000,000.00 for project construction costs; to authorize the appropriation and transfer of $1,278,918.38 from the Sanitary Sewer Reserve Fund to the Sanitary Sewer General Obligation Bond Fund, to authorize the expenditure of $6,916,818.38 which utilizes approved funds of $3,137,900.00 from a Water Resource Restoration Sponsor Program (WRRSP) Agreement; to amend the 2012 Capital Improvements Budget; and to declare an emergency. Explanation

1. BACKGROUND:

Need: This legislation authorizes the Director of Public Utilities to enter into a construction contract with Evans Landscaping, Inc. for $6,916,818.38 for the 5th Ave Dam Removal and Lower Olentangy River Ecosystem Restoration Project; to enter into a subcontract agreement for $2,000,000.00 with The Ohio State University for construction of said project and to utilize $3,137,900.00 from a Water Resource Restoration Sponsor Program (WRRSP) Agreement from the Ohio Environmental Protection Agency (OEPA) and Ohio Water Development Authority (OWDA) which was approved in Ordinance 0575-2011. As part of this project the City has entered into Environmental Covenants for the purpose of restoring, maintaining and protecting, in perpetuity, the Conservation Values identified in the WRRSP Agreement as stipulated in Ordinance 0951-2012.

This project consists of removing the 5th Avenue Dam and restoring approximately 8,500 LF of the Olentangy River using natural channel design techniques, and other such work as may be necessary to complete the contract in accordance with the plans (CC-15943) and specifications. The project construction limits are within the City of Columbus. The project timeline is 515 days from the issuance of the Notice to Proceed (NTP)

2. Procurement Information: The Division advertised for competitive bid proposals on the City of Columbus's Vendor Services website and in the City Bulletin in accordance with the provisions of Section 329.14 of Columbus City Codes. The Division of Sewerage and Drainage opened the responding bids on May 9, 2012 from the following five (5) companies. The ranking was as follows:
